Understanding Areola Restoration


Areola restoration is a specialized procedure aimed at reconstructing or enhancing the areola's appearance. This service is particularly beneficial for individuals who have undergone breast surgeries, such as mastectomies, or those who have experienced changes due to aging or hormonal shifts.

The Areola Restoration Process


Initial Consultation


The journey begins with an initial consultation with a qualified specialist. During this meeting, the practitioner will assess your needs, discuss your goals, and explain the available options. This is also an opportunity for you to ask questions and express any concerns.


Procedure Options


There are several methods for areola restoration, including:


  • Tattooing: This is a popular option for those looking to enhance or recreate the areola's appearance. The process involves using specialized pigments to match the natural color of the areola.


  • 3D Areola Tattooing: This advanced technique creates a realistic three-dimensional effect, making the areola appear more lifelike.


  • Surgical Reconstruction: In some cases, surgical options may be available to reconstruct the areola. This is typically recommended for individuals who have undergone significant breast surgery.


What to Expect During the Procedure


The procedure itself is usually straightforward and can often be completed in a single session. Here’s what you can expect:


  1. Preparation: The area will be cleaned and prepped to ensure a sterile environment.


  2. Numbing: A local anesthetic may be applied to minimize discomfort during the procedure.


  3. Application: Depending on the chosen method, the practitioner will either tattoo or surgically reconstruct the areola.


  4. Aftercare: Post-procedure care is crucial for optimal healing. Your practitioner will provide specific instructions on how to care for the area.


Recovery and Aftercare


Recovery from areola restoration is generally quick, but it varies depending on the method used. Here are some common aftercare tips:


  • Keep the Area Clean: Gently wash the area with mild soap and water.


  • Avoid Sun Exposure: Protect the area from direct sunlight to prevent fading.


  • Follow-Up Appointments: Attend any scheduled follow-up appointments to ensure proper healing and address any concerns.

Frequently Asked Questions


Is Areola Restoration Painful?


Most individuals report minimal discomfort during the procedure due to the use of local anesthetics. After the procedure, some tenderness may occur, but it is usually manageable.


How Long Does the Procedure Take?


The duration of the procedure varies depending on the method used. Generally, it can take anywhere from one to three hours.


Will Insurance Cover Areola Restoration?


Insurance coverage for areola restoration varies by provider and individual circumstances. It’s advisable to check with your insurance company to understand your options.


How Soon Can I Return to Normal Activities?


Most individuals can return to their regular activities within a few days, but it’s essential to follow your practitioner’s aftercare instructions for the best results.
